QUATRE BRAS CUP

Southland Beats Marlborough

Southland won the Quatre Bras Cup when it beat Marlborough, 4-2 in the final of the South Island Minor Associations’ championship at Williamson Park on Saturday. The match was played as a curtain-raiser to the Shield Challenge game between Canterbury and Otago. The match was virtually decided in the first half when Southland built up a lead of three goals, and although Marlborough made a determined effort In the second spell the margin was too great. Play was very fast, and the territorial exchanges were more even than the score suggested. The Southland goals were scored by H. Eastwood, D. Brown. P. Tillard and D. Hughes, while R. Wefctman and D. Petherbridge scored for Marlborough. Umpires:—Messrs B. Lloyd and S. I Swift.
